Divya Delhi: The houses of Malayalam stars Dulquer Salmaan and Prithviraj Sukumaran were raided during Operation “Numkhor.” The Customs Preventive Wing is investigating. The Kerala-wide operation targeted unlawful Bhutanese automobile imports. Authorities are probing Bhutanese vehicles imported with fraudulent registrations to dodge taxes, according to PTI. Officials verified that Dulquer and Prithviraj's car documents are being reviewed.The operation, named after Bhutanese term “Numkhor” for vehicle, encompasses Kochi, Thiruvananthapuram, Kozhikode, and Malappuram. About 15 infractions have been reported. Actor Amit Chakkalackal's automobiles are also under investigation. The police believe over 100 Land Rovers, Land Cruisers, and Prados were smuggled into Kerala and bought by Malayalam stars.Both had a successful year professionally despite the scandals.
